Building a business or managing finances isn't just about spreadsheets and revenue projections it's about resilience.
There are days when everything flows. Clients respond, systems work, and numbers align. But then come the other days when invoices delay, expenses climb, and motivation dips without warning. The truth? That’s all part of the journey.
Business and finance are often romanticized, especially online. But real-world growth is layered. It means balancing bold ideas with tight margins. It means making decisions with incomplete information and learning, sometimes painfully, what not to do.

For entrepreneurs, it’s the pressure of turning a dream into something that feeds others. For professionals, it’s the challenge of navigating corporate structures while staying financially empowered personally. And for many, the line between business and personal finance is thin blurry, even.
Understanding your numbers isn’t optional, it’s your safety net and your launchpad. Knowing how to build a sustainable model, create alternate income streams, manage risk, and plan for growth doesn’t remove the stress… but it gives you control.
That control is what separates those who burn out from those who build long-term success.
